项目介绍

随着网络科技的发展,移动智能终端逐渐走进人们的视线,相关应用越来越广泛,并在人们的日常生活中扮演着越来越重要的角色。因此,关键应用程序的开发成为影响移动智能终端普及的重要因素,设计并开发实用、方便的应用程序具有重要的意义和良好的市场前景。HBuilder X系统作为当前最流行的操作平台,自然也存在着大量的应用服务需求。
本课题研究的是基于HBuilder X系统平台的师生答疑交流APP,开发这款师生答疑交流APP主要是为了帮助用户可以不用约束时间与地点进行所需信息。本文详细讲述了师生答疑交流APP的界面设计及使用,主要包括界面的实现、控件的使用、界面的布局和异常的处理等内容,将准确的师生答疑交流APP呈现给用户。
开发语言:Java
框架:ssm
JDK版本:JDK1.8
服务器:tomcat7
数据库:mysql 5.7(一定要5.7版本)
数据库工具:Navicat11
开发软件:eclipse/myeclipse/idea
Maven包:Maven3.3.9

安卓框架:uniapp
安卓开发软件:HBuilder X
开发模式:混合开发

从上面的描述中可以基本了解软件的功能需求:
1、启动App Widget应用程序;
2、设置界面:对要显示“师生答疑交流APP”的信息及更新信息进行设置;
3、详细界面:通过文字图片显示当前的发布问题、问题答疑、评教信息、在线交流、知识学习、学校意见箱等信息;
4、显示界面:通过文字和图片显示当前的师生答疑交流APP情况。
根据系统功能需求建立的模块关系图如下图:

图3-1 系统结构图

前端




后端




目 录

摘 要 I
Abstract II
目 录 III
第1章 绪论 1
1.1选题背景 2
1.2研究现状及发展趋势 3
1.3课题的研究意义 6
1.4研究内容 6
第2章 相关技术 7
2.1 java简介 7
2.2 Mysql数据库 7
2.3 HBuilder X技术介绍 9
2.4 SSM三大框架 9
第3章 系统分析 11
3.1研究目标 11
3.2系统可行性分析 11
3.3系统功能需求分析 12
3.4性能分析 13
3.5其它需求 14
第4章 系统设计 16
4.1概述 16
4.2项目设计目标与原则 16
4.3数据表 18
第5章 系统实现 21
5.1学生前端功能模块 21
5.2教师前端功能模块 21
5.3管理员后端功能模块 23
5.4教师后端功能模块 23
第6章 系统测试 27
6.1系统测试的目的 27
6.2测试方法及用例 27
结 论 30
致 谢 31
参考文献 32

基于微信小程序的师生答疑交流平台APP-计算机毕业设计相关推荐

  1. 小程序项目:基于微信小程序的师生答疑交流平台APP——计算机毕业设计

    项目介绍 随着网络科技的发展,移动智能终端逐渐走进人们的视线,相关应用越来越广泛,并在人们的日常生活中扮演着越来越重要的角色.因此,关键应用程序的开发成为影响移动智能终端普及的重要因素,设计并开发实用 ...

  2. 基于微信小程序的师生答疑交流平台APP

    随着网络科技的发展,移动智能终端逐渐走进人们的视线,相关应用越来越广泛,并在人们的日常生活中扮演着越来越重要的角色.因此,关键应用程序的开发成为影响移动智能终端普及的重要因素,设计并开发实用.方便的应 ...

  3. java基于微信小程序的师生答疑交流平台 uniAPP小程序

    随着网络科技的发展,移动智能终端逐渐走进人们的视线,相关应用越来越广泛,并在人们的日常生活中扮演着越来越重要的角色.因此,关键应用程序的开发成为影响移动智能终端普及的重要因素,设计并开发实用.方便的应 ...

  4. 基于安卓/android/微信小程序的流动人口管理移动APP#计算机毕业设计

    项目介绍 通过利用信息化管理技术对社区流动人口状况进行汇总分析,对流动人口数量.年龄结构.流动方向.经营情况.计划生育情况以及在本区分布情况.投资情况等数据进行系统分析,开发一套符合当地社区的流动人口 ...

  5. 基于微信小程序的家校通系统-计算机毕业设计

    运行环境 开发语言:Java 框架:ssm JDK版本:JDK1.8 服务器:tomcat7 数据库:mysql 5.7(一定要5.7版本) 数据库工具:Navicat11 开发软件:eclipse/ ...

  6. 【计算机毕业设计】基于微信小程序的师生答疑平台的设计与实现

    毕设帮助.源码交流及指导 见文末 随着网络时代的到来,互联网的优势和普及时刻影响并改变着人们的生活方式.在信息技术迅速发展的今天,计算机技术已经遍及全球,使社会发生了巨大的变革. 为了不受时间和地点的 ...

  7. java基于微信小程序的英语学习激励系统-计算机毕业设计

    网络技术的快速发展给各行各业带来了很大的突破,也给各行各业提供了一种新的管理技术,对于微信小程序的英语学习激励系统将又是一个传统管理到智能化信息管理的典型案例,对于传统的英语学习激励管理,所包括的信息 ...

  8. java基于微信小程序的鲜花销售系统 uinapp 计算机毕业设计

    网络购物己经成为一个常态化的消费手段,足不出户即可享受互联网发展的红利,对于购物商城的应用,普通消费者目前普遍使用.鲜花作为一个大众消费的商品,由于其健康的特点,也越来越为大家喜欢,本系统是一个垂直电 ...

  9. 小程序项目:基于微信小程序社区疫情防控系统——计算机毕业设计

    项目介绍 小程序社区疫情防控系统的设计主要是对系统所要实现的功能进行详细考虑,确定所要实现的功能后进行界面的设计,在这中间还要考虑如何可以更好的将功能及页面进行很好的结合,方便用户可以很容易明了的找到 ...

最新文章

  1. hadoop商品推荐_百战卓越班学员学习经验分享:商品推荐
  2. 2018 CVPR GAN 相关论文调研 (自己分了下类,附地址哦)
  3. 互联网跨界营销掘金“大数据”
  4. SQL大圣之路笔记——SQL 创建索引 index
  5. java中事务实例,Java Spring 事务管理器入门例子教程(TranscationManager)
  6. 微软为.NET程序员带来了最优的跨平台开发体验-WSL
  7. 统计单词出现的次数并进行排
  8. (转)mybatis热部署加载*Mapper.xml文件,手动刷新*Mapper.xml文件
  9. E百科 | 第2期 扒一扒能加速互联网的QUIC协议
  10. php装箱,php兑现装箱算法
  11. Qt创建任务栏进度条
  12. php如何控制用户对图片的访问 PHP禁止图片盗链
  13. python基础学习笔记1
  14. ThreadGroup(线程组)
  15. 个人计算机预防勒索病毒,避免电脑中勒索病毒的方法
  16. 用ruby编写标准计算器_WatirMaker再次用Ruby编写
  17. python重复import_Python 中循环 import 造成的问题如何解决?
  18. 对称加密+非对称加密,实现数据安全传输
  19. Latex/CTex/WinEdt 期刊双栏排版图表中英文标题走过的那些坑
  20. 区块链的硬分叉、软分叉介绍

热门文章

  1. 分享系列--面试JAVA架构师--链家网
  2. 油酸Oleic acid/氨基NH2/羧基COOH/PEG/蛋白Prote/抗体antibody/PAA/SiO2修饰的上转换纳米材料NaY(Gd/Lu/Nd)F4:Yb,Er
  3. win7系统下连网络打印机打印反应很慢解决方法
  4. 在英特尔硬件上部署深度学习模型的无代码方法 OpenVINO 深度学习工作台的三部分系列 - CPU AI 第二部
  5. 小红书竞品分析_小红书与网易考拉 竞品分析报告
  6. 魏小亮:如何选择硅谷的IT公司
  7. java课程表_用Java做个课程表(5)
  8. IrfanView 看图软件下载及汉化
  9. 微软裁员方式曝光:鼓励自愿退休 减少合同工
  10. 结合Elementplus源码讲解BEM的使用